Just purchased a 97 Eddie Bauer to pull a little 16 foot runabout. The stock bumper setup is rusted to ****. There are no holes and it still seems together, but there is large amounts of rusted metal on it. Do you think it safe for the mean time until I can upgrade to a real tow hitch?
 






If you're going to tow something and it's more than just surface rust, it would be a good idea to remove the bumper and the brackets, and remove the hitch plate from the bumper, sand the rust off, and repaint the brackets and hitch plate with some rust preventative paint.

This will let you check if any of the pieces are actually rusted so badly that they would be unsafe in a towing setup, and also that all the bolts and brackets are on tight.
